On this episode of the Afros and Knives podcast, host Tiffani Rozier interviews Rahanna Bisseret Martinez, a young chef who was a finalist on Top Chef Junior and now cookbook author. Rihanna shares how she first started cooking with her mom in the kitchen and how that sparked her interest in cooking. She also talks about her experience on Top Chef Junior and how she didn't expect the opportunities that have come her way since the show. Rihanna shares her aspirations of owning her own restaurant someday. The conversation is both aspirational and re-energizing, showcasing the talent and capability of young people like Chef Martinez in the culinary industry.
